The David Kramer-run Big Three representation giant inked a long-term lease at Civic Center Drive with the building’s owner, investment firm DivCore Capital, which unveiled the new deal. (The year that the lease runs through wasn’t disclosed.)
The agency occupies two four-story buildings and 192,000-square-feet as the sole tenant of the complex, which originally was Hilton Hotels’ HQ when it opened in 1985.
UTA had been based at Civic Center since 2012 after it signed a 15-year lease at the time following a move from its old Wilshire Blvd digs. That was around the time the agency opened its Seventh Avenue office in New York. In L.A, it enlisted architecture firm Rottet Studio for an extensive series of renovations said to cost around $30 million for Civic Center.
